Published 1993. Biology. The PhenePlateTM (PhP) System is a quantitative typing system based upon computerised numerical analysis of biochemical fingerprints of bacterial strains. It takes advantage of differences in reaction speed among isolates and it gives simple and automatic identification of biochemical phenotypes.
